Mod Rewrite将同时接受斜杠和不斜杠

时间:2012-11-25 13:39:08

标签: mod-rewrite

我目前在我的htaccess文件中有这个

RewriteRule ^(cms/.*)$ cms.php?querystring=$1 [L,QSA]

这是为了获取域名之后的所有内容

目前,如果我输入www.mydomain/classified/则没有问题

但如果我输入www.mydomain/classified(最后没有斜线),它将触发404页面

我需要修改重写规则[^(cms/.*)$],如果我输入它将不会触发404页面 www.mydomain/classified(最后没有斜线)

但如果我输入

将显示404
www.mydomain/classified-any-text-here/

www.mydomain/classified-any-text-here

1 个答案:

答案 0 :(得分:0)

您可以测试以下代码

 [^(cms/?.*)$]